EV Charging Cost Calculator

Calculate the cost of charging your electric vehicle from its battery capacity, current and target charge level, electricity price, and charging efficiency.

How to Use the EV Charging Cost Calculator

  1. Enter your EV's "Battery Capacity (kWh)".
  2. Enter the "Current Charge (%)" and "Target Charge (%)" you're charging to.
  3. Enter your "Electricity Price (₹/kWh)" and the charger's "Charging Efficiency (%)" (typically 85-95%, lower for AC home charging).
  4. Click "Calculate Charging Cost" to see the energy added and total cost.

Charging isn't 100% efficient - some energy is lost as heat during the AC-to-DC conversion process. So you're billed for more electricity from the grid than actually ends up stored in the battery.

Home AC charging is typically 85-90% efficient, while DC fast charging can be slightly more efficient at 90-95%. Check your charger or EV manufacturer's specifications for a more precise figure.
